House prices in Sevenoaks
Official UK HPI · to June 2026
House prices in Sevenoaks have risen sharply over the past year — up +3.2% to a typical £543,081, one of the larger 12-month gains recorded in the UK. Terraced property led the rise, with typical prices now at £429,801.
That's 100% above the UK average of £272,188.

Prices by property type
- Detached £1,017,388 ▲ +2.1%
- Semi-detached £542,756 ▲ +4.1%
- Terraced £429,801 ▲ +4.4%
- Flat £283,224 ▲ +1.3%

Affordability
A typical home in Sevenoaks costs 10.8× local annual earnings (ONS, latest year). See how Sevenoaks ranks nationally →
Sevenoaks is the 36th least affordable of 317 UK areas we track.
Energy efficiency profile
Based on 37,530 Energy Performance Certificates lodged for properties in Sevenoaks.
- Most common rating D
- Rated A-C 40%
- Median floor area 87 m²
- Median annual energy cost £978
- Most common era England and Wales: 1950-1966
- Main heating fuel mains gas (not community)

- How much does a house survey cost in Sevenoaks?
- Surveyors price by property value, size and age. For a home around Sevenoaks's average of £543,081, expect roughly £600–£850 for a RICS Level 2 (Homebuyer) survey, or £1,000–£1,500 for a Level 3 Building Survey on older or unusual property. - How much does it cost to sell a house in Sevenoaks?
- On a typical Sevenoaks sale at £543,081, high-street estate-agent commission (1.0–1.5% + VAT) comes to roughly £6,500–£9,800, with sale-side conveyancing adding £900–£1,800. - How much does it cost to move home in Sevenoaks?
- Moving home in Sevenoaks typically involves conveyancing (~£900–£1,800 inc. VAT and searches), a survey if you're buying (~£400–£1,300 depending on level), and removals (~£400–£1,200 for a 2–3 bedroom move). See our full cost-of-moving-home guide for every line in the bill.
